Their chart doesn't have your model year, but I use Dongar Dashcam Power Adapter (16-pin Type A) for Ford Vehicles. Double check power connector on the mirror, it may be same. I use it with Vantrue E1Pro. I also have different Viofo dashcams in my other cars. I think both these brands are on top of their game.
P.S. There is also Mangoal brand for the mirror power adapter that lists Mustangs for 2015+, but i am not familiar with them.

I run a Wolfbox 900 Pro in my GT350 R and Bronco WIldtrak. 4K front camera and 2.5k rear camera with GPS integration. I use it for off-road recording and track days as well. Replaces your rear mirror. Can also be setup to do parking lot surveillance.

Video and still quality from the front camera is amazing. Rear camera at 2.5k is also really good. Hardest part of the install was finding a 12V hot source in the fuse block. Since most cars stay in accsy mode before 100% shut down, you either a) have to be patient or b) need to know which damn fuse is hot all the time.

Mirror has 3 cables / wires coming out of the top: Power, GPS and Rear Camera. I tucked them into the headliner, ran all 3 over to the driver's A-pillar, ran power and GPS down the a-pillar and rear camera wire under the headliner and back to the rear headliner. I have my rear camera mounted inside the cabin I don't use it for a backup camera, so the lines are turned off.
